There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Norwood is 20.5% cheaper than Efland. With a cost index of 75 vs 90,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Norwood to Efland should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Efland are $192,900 compared to $178,900 in Norwood, a 8% gap.

Median household income in Efland is $72,396 compared to $57,953 in Norwood (+24.9%). While Efland is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
